Tesla’s Journey into the Future: A Step Closer to Robotaxis with New Permit

Tesla has received a Transportation Charter Permit (TCP) from the California Public Utilities Commission, boosting its stock by approximately 4% in pre-market trading. The permit allows Tesla to provide prearranged transportation with its own vehicles, targeting employee transit rather than public ride-hailing
